Thank you for signing the petition requesting that our Board of Trustees call an emergency meeting with faculty to address the impact COVID-19 has had on both faculty and students.
We reached out to the President of the Board of Trustees, Susan Fish, and she directed us to work with our deans and management to communicate our needs. We mentioned that this strategy does not appear to be working in time to deal with the crisis we face now. We were also directed to reach out to the Chancellor about the many outstanding issues concerning the stay-in-place order. The meeting with the Chancellor was very cordial however he did not give any commitments concerning our four main issues:
- extra pay due to COVID;
- reimbursement for tech expenses;
- payment for late-start classes that were cancelled due to COVID;
- lowering enrollment caps, offering more sections (not fewer), and payment guarantees for faculty affected by class cancellations.
Tomorrow, May 5th, there is a Board of Trustees meeting at 7:00 pm. Some faculty plan to speak during the public comment portion of this meeting. Public comment will likely start anytime between 7:00 pm and 7:30 pm (we don't have the exact time).
We wanted to let you know in case you want to zoom in, listen, and support your colleagues.
